Authentik is an open source identity provider designed for maximum flexibility and adaptability. It integrates easily into existing environments and supports new protocols.

Open source identity

It is a comprehensive solution for implementing features such as login, account recovery and more in your application, eliminating the need to manage these tasks manually.

Authentik integrates seamlessly into an existing environment to add support for new protocols without requiring significant refactoring. It supports all major providers, including OAuth2, SAML, LDAP and SCIM, allowing the selection of the appropriate protocol for each application.

“The customizability and ability to implement any possible workflow sets Authentik apart from most identity providers. We offer a wide range of support for protocols and integrations with the ability to automate everything via our API, Terraform or our Blueprint system. Authentik was designed from the start to give administrators the freedom to configure Identity to suit their needs and they don’t have to change their processes to work with Authentik,” Jens Langhammer, CTO of Authentik Security, told Help Net Security.

Future plans and download

“Features we plan to expand in the future include privileged access management with customizable approval flows and time-based access, desktop authentication agents, device trust, and more zero-trust networking capabilities for complex environments. In addition, we want to continue to improve the overall UX and work with customers to implement the things they need,” Langhammer said.

Authentik is available for free on GitHub.
